An F-22 Raptor lands at Kadena Air Base Jan. 12 following a 10-hour flight from Hickam Air Force Base, Hawaii. One of 12 Raptors deployed from Langley Air Force Base, Va., the aircraft is part of an air expeditionary force rotation. (U.S. Air Force photo/Tech. Sgt. Rey Ramon)
